Presentation: From L&D to organizational learning: are knowledge models the key to closing critical information gaps?
Companies work hard to keep employees, partners, and customers informed, but traditional L&D approaches - such as content creation, training, and assessments / often fall short. Several challenges contribute to gaps in training and knowledge retention:
- Content quickly becomes outdated
- Knowledge gets siloed
- Employee turnover leads to a loss of expertise
- Individuals are often unmotivated to engage in training sessions.
Could knowledge models be the solution to keeping critical information up-to-date and consistent across departments? Knowledge models address these issues by centralizing key information and ensuring it remains current with the help of subject matter experts (SMEs). KM can be applied to various learning activities, including real-time support through chat.
